I put this shaft in my driver in June 2010 and really didn't know what to expect. I have spent quite some time searching for the right driver shaft to fit my game, whiteboard, ozik HD, fubuki, etc. I put the DI 6X in my driver and absolutely love it, it gives great feedback through impact, as well as a tight shot dispersion for me. To my swing characteristics I compare it to a Diamana Whiteboard, but I hit the DI about 10 yards further due to the higher launch of the shaft. I would highly recommend this to anyone who is looking for a great feeling shaft combined with distance and accuracy (lethal combo). I just recently got the DI 7X for my 3 wood and can't wait to play it for a couple months or so to get the feedback on that as well. Hope this helps!

With correct tipping, this is a mid launch low spin beast. I have a 7 TX in a driver and it's killer. I've fit many people into the 6 for a higher launch with a touch of spin and the 7 and 8 for stronger players and fairway woods. As with all of the Tour AD line, tipping is crucial. Get it right and it's the best!

I was fitting yesterday for a new R11. The place had the stock offerings and many top of the line shafts set up for fitting purposes with the R11 (I'm guessing TM gives them sleeves for extra shafts). Although the specs are different, it feels a lot like a Diamana Whiteboard as "RedHawk59" mentioned. I couldn't believe it. My spin was at 2600-2700 on average with this shaft. Trackman numbers were the best I have had. This shaft is long with tight dispersion too. It was the only AD DI-6 they had with the R11 tip...they had two DI-7's tipped, but said they would order me a DI-6 and tip it. Of course I left with the DI-6 in the new R11. I still have my Diamana Whiteboard pull but I think I will be playing this shaft.

Well after a couple of rounds with this shaft Im really starting to love it. As I stated above I went with the S flex instead of the X flex. It holds up well and its deep if I slow the back swing down. For me I have a lot of feel with this shaft in my 9064LS. I can feel where it hits the club face, heel toes high or low on the club face. I don't know all the tech terms but I can feel the lag of the club head and the kick point in the shaft. The kick point to me feels a little closer to the hands, I'm not sure if that is where I should be feeling it though, since this is a high launching shaft.

For me I have been hitting the ball higher then I ever have before with a lot less spin.

I have been getting some of my longest drives ever. These numbers are like the numbers I was putting up when I lived in Colorado Springs.

I think I will be having it cut down from a 45.5 to a 44.5. or 45 or top tipped a half inch. At this time I have now confidence in this club because I'm all over the place. I hope tipping it or cutting it down will help me control my shot a little/lot more.

Pro: high launch, low spin, great feel, smooth feeling if you like that type of shaft

Cons: for me, the price, yes I know there are shafts out that cost a lot more and don't preform as well but I just wish it cost a little less in case I didn't like it.
